BJP leader accuses Mehbooba of playing communal card with an eye on election

Press Trust of India  |  Jammu 

Days after PDP alleged that the nomadic Gujjar and Bakerwal communities were being "selectively targeted" in Jammu region, a Tuesday accused her of playing "communal card" with an eye on the upcoming polls in the state.

"We have been living in communal harmony for centuries and the PDP supremo must not try to disturb the prevailing peace in the region by playing dirty based upon communal and regional divide to gain votes," told reporters here.

Haroon, flanked by several Muslim leaders of the (BJP), denied the claim of the former

On Sunday, Mehbooba had alleged that the Gujjar and Bakerwal communities were being "selectively targeted" in the Jammu region and warned that if the issue was not addressed by the S P Malik-led administration, the consequences would be "dangerous".
